Germany, Kriegsmarine. A U-Boat Front Clasp, Bronze Grade, by Schwerin & Sons visually-hidden as well as some running(U Boot Frontspange). May 15th, 1944. (Mid to late war issue). Constructed of bronzed zink, the obverse consisting of an oval laurel leaf wreath, joined together at the bottom by crossed swords, topped by a Kriegsmarine eagle clutching a mobile swastika, flanked on each side by six oak leaves, the reverse with an integral hinge and banjo style pinback meeting a crimped wire catch, designer marked PEEKHAUS and maker marked SCHWERIN, BERLIN, measuring
